In addition to our Estate Pinot Noir, which is comprised of a blend of up to 5 clones of Pinot Noir grown in our estate vineyard, we bottle small batches of individual clones and release them to our Allocation Club members each year. These are called our "Estate Small Block Collection" wines. Members also enjoy exclusive access to our "Robert's Reserve" Estate Pinot Noir and exclusive access to our Library wines.

2009 Estate Pinot Noir "Wild One"

Release Price: $48.00

Only a few cases of our "Wild One" were made in 2009. Brandon took a barrel of wine off our "Triple Seven" block Pinot Noir and let it naturally ferment using wild yeast. 

This was the first experiment using wild yeast, and it's always an uncertainty the first time if there would be enough wild yeast or quality natural yeast present to ferment the grapes adequately and yield a structured, balanced, delicious wine.

Strikingly different from our other wines, the "Wild One" is less fruit forward than our other estate wines, has much more earthiness, and is bold and delicious.

2005 Estate Pinot Noir

Release Price: $48.00 / Library Price: $78.00

95 Points at the 2008 Pinot Shootout Competition

This wine is a combination of the 667, 777, and Pommard clones. Aged 18 months, 9 of which is in new French oak. At the Pinot Shootout, where it scored 95 points, it was the top Pinot Noir tasted among men. Collectively, the men reviewing the wine wrote "medium ruby, a lovely color. Delicious cherry, raspberry aromas. Refined, soft attack with a ripe forward palate. Nicely integrated and classy." Women also gave the 2005 high scores and notes that has "light fresh strawberry aromas with a touch of earthiness. Strawberry and cranberry flavors with lemon on the finish. Light and easy to drink with nice acid. A crowd pleaser".
